Question Making Flash Intro Link To Home Page


Hey all,
New to the group, and I've got a few quick questions that I'm sure will seem easy to you. First, I have created a flash animation using a program called "SwishMax". What I need to know is how can I make this the intro to my website? What I mean by this is how can I make it so that the flash animation is the first thing shown, and then it links to the framedef? Also, how can I get my menu on the left side to be on the top or bottom?

SwishMax will create the page for you. When you are done and you have created that link that says "skip intro" with the link to your real homepage, (link is the real home page)

simply go to file,
export
export as HTML+SWF
it will save the page with the SWF file.
rename the file to whatever your server is set up by default for a home page (index, default)
